Product details

Overview

DP83867ERGZR from Texas Instruments is a robust, extended-temperature Ethernet PHY transceiver supporting 10/100/1000BASE-T protocols with RGMII/SGMII MAC interface options, 457 mW full-power consumption, <90 ns TX / <290 ns RX latency, and 8 kV IEC 61000-4-2 ESD protection on MDI pins - deployed in industrial motor drives and factory automation systems requiring deterministic timing and high immunity.

For engineers reviewing the DP83867ERGZR datasheet, DP83867ERGZR pinout, DP83867ERGZR application, or DP83867ERGZR equivalent, this page delivers verified electrical specs, validated RGMII/SGMII timing behavior, confirmed -40°C to +105°C operating range, IEEE 1588 Start of Frame detection capability, and real-world cable diagnostics implementation guidance - all specific to the DP83867ERGZR variant.

Technical Context

The DP83867ERGZR implements a fully integrated PMD sublayer compliant with IEEE 802.3 for 10BASE-Te, 100BASE-TX, and 1000BASE-T over twisted-pair media, with internal MDI termination resistors and programmable MAC interface impedance (1.8 V/2.5 V/3.3 V). It supports synchronous Ethernet clock output at 25 MHz or 125 MHz and provides IEEE 1588 Start of Frame Detect with ±4 ns receive SFD variation in 1000BASE-T mode.

Its architecture enables Time-Sensitive Networking (TSN) compliance via low-latency data paths (<90 ns TX, <290 ns RX), 16 programmable RGMII delay modes, and RJ45 mirror mode for physical-layer debugging - all within a single 48-pin VQFN (RGZ) package rated for extended temperature operation up to +105°C junction.

Key Specifications

ParameterValue and Actual Design Meaning
Interface StandardFully compliant with IEEE 802.3 10BASE-Te, 100BASE-TX, and 1000BASE-T; supports RGMII and SGMII MAC interfaces
Latency (TX/RX)<90 ns transmit / <290 ns receive - enables TSN-critical deterministic packet forwarding in industrial control loops
Power Consumption457 mW at 1000BASE-T full operation with optional 3-supply configuration - reduces thermal load in dense embedded designs
ESD Protection±8 kV IEC 61000-4-2 contact discharge on MDI pins (1,2,4,5,7,8,10,11) - ensures robustness in noisy factory environments
Operating Temperature-40°C to +105°C ambient - qualified for extended-temperature industrial applications including motor drives and fieldbus gateways
Clock Outputs25 MHz or 125 MHz synchronized clock output - supports precise timing alignment for IEEE 1588 timestamping and synchronous Ethernet
Start of Frame DetectIEEE 1588-compliant SFD detection with ±4 ns variation in 1000BASE-T receive path - enables sub-microsecond time synchronization accuracy

Pinout & Package

DP83867ERGZR uses a 48-pin VQFN package (RGZ), 7 mm × 7 mm, with exposed thermal pad (DAP = GND). Pin functions are validated per TI SNLS504G Rev JUNE 2026.

Pin/TerminalCircuit RoleDesign Meaning
TD_P_A / TD_M_A
TD_P_B / TD_M_B
TD_P_C / TD_M_C
TD_P_D / TD_M_D
MDI Differential PairsFour twisted-pair differential lanes for 1000BASE-T signaling; require external magnetics and comply with IEEE 802.3 Annex 40B
GTX_CLK / RX_CLKRGMII Clock SignalsGTX_CLK: 125 MHz input from MAC; RX_CLK: 2.5/25/125 MHz recovered clock output - defines RGMII timing budget and skew constraints
TX_D0–TX_D3 / RX_D0–RX_D3RGMII Data Lanes4-bit parallel data paths synchronized to GTX_CLK/RX_CLK; support 10/100/1000 Mbps with internal delay calibration
SGMII_SIP/SON/COP/CONSGMII Differential I/OAC-coupled 625 MHz differential clock/data interface - eliminates external clock buffer and simplifies high-speed layout
MDC / MDIOIEEE 802.3 Management Interface25 MHz max serial bus for register access; MDIO requires 2.2 kΩ pull-up; enables runtime configuration and link diagnostics
INT/PWDNInterrupt / Power-Down ControlOpen-drain interrupt output or active-low power-down entry - supports Wake-on-LAN and low-power sleep states

Key Features

FeatureDesign Value
Programmable RGMII Delay16 discrete RX/TX delay modes - compensates for PCB trace length mismatch without external delay lines
Integrated MDI TerminationOn-die 50 Ω termination resistors - eliminates 8 external 50 Ω resistors and saves 24 mm² PCB area
Configurable I/O VoltageSupports 1.8 V / 2.5 V / 3.3 V VDDIO - enables direct interfacing with diverse MACs without level shifters
Cable DiagnosticsReal-time open/short/fault detection on all four MDI pairs - replaces external TDR hardware in field service tools
Wake-on-LAN DetectionHardware-accelerated magic packet recognition - allows system-level power gating while maintaining network responsiveness

Applications

Industrial Motor DrivesFactory Automation Controllers

Use Scenario: Real-time EtherCAT or PROFINET communication between PLC and servo drives in CNC machinery.

IC Role / Device Role / Timing Role: PHY layer transceiver providing deterministic 1000BASE-T link with <90 ns TX latency and IEEE 1588 Start of Frame detection.

Use Value: Enables sub-1 µs synchronization accuracy across distributed drive axes, meeting IEC 61800-3 EMC and motion control jitter requirements.

Use Scenario: High-density I/O modules in modular PLC backplanes requiring noise-immune Ethernet connectivity.

IC Role / Device Role / Timing Role: Robust PHY with ±8 kV IEC 61000-4-2 ESD protection on MDI pins and -40°C to +105°C operation.

Use Value: Eliminates field failures due to electrostatic discharge in dusty factory environments and supports extended thermal cycling life.

Fieldbus Protocol GatewaysTest & Measurement Equipment

Use Scenario: Bridging Modbus TCP or EtherNet/IP to legacy RS-485 fieldbus networks in process instrumentation.

IC Role / Device Role / Timing Role: Dual-mode RGMII/SGMII interface enabling flexible MAC integration with ARM Cortex-M7 or FPGA-based protocol stacks.

Use Value: Reduces BOM count by integrating programmable MAC termination and eliminating external clock buffers or level shifters.

Use Scenario: Portable oscilloscopes and signal analyzers requiring remote control via Ethernet with minimal latency.

IC Role / Device Role / Timing Role: Low-latency PHY with RJ45 mirror mode and cable diagnostics for on-site troubleshooting.

Use Value: Allows engineers to verify physical-layer integrity and isolate cabling faults without external TDR equipment.

Equivalent & Alternatives

The following parts are listed as comparable options for similar Ethernet PHY applications.

Alternative PartTechnical DifferenceApplication DifferenceSelection Advice
DP83867ISRGZSame pinout and feature set; rated for -40°C to +85°C ambient (vs. +105°C for DP83867ERGZR)Suitable for standard industrial controllers but not extended-temperature motor drives or enclosures near heat sourcesSelect DP83867ISRGZ only if ambient temperature remains ≤85°C and cost sensitivity outweighs thermal margin needs.
Marvell Alaska 88E1512Different pinout (64-pin QFN); supports SGMII/RGMII but lacks integrated 25 MHz oscillator input and RJ45 mirror modeUsed in telecom infrastructure where higher channel count and multi-port switching are requiredChoose 88E1512 only when migrating from Marvell-based designs or requiring multi-port PHY aggregation.

Compared with DP83867ISRGZ and 88E1512, the DP83867ERGZR uniquely combines extended temperature rating (+105°C), on-chip 25 MHz crystal interface, and RJ45 mirror mode - making it the only option for thermally constrained industrial edge nodes requiring physical-layer debug visibility and guaranteed operation at full spec.

FAQ

What is the maximum operating junction temperature for DP83867ERGZR?

The DP83867ERGZR has a maximum operating junction temperature of +125°C, validated under recommended operating conditions with thermal metrics RθJA = 30.8°C/W and RθJC(bot) = 1.4°C/W. This specification ensures reliable operation in sealed enclosures or near heat-generating components when using the exposed DAP for thermal conduction. The DP83867ERGZR datasheet specifies derating above +105°C ambient based on actual board-level thermal resistance.

Does DP83867ERGZR support both RGMII and SGMII interfaces simultaneously?

No, DP83867ERGZR supports RGMII or SGMII operation - not both simultaneously. Interface selection is determined at power-up via hardware configuration pins (GPIO_0/GPIO_1) or software register settings. RGMII uses single-ended 125 MHz GTX_CLK/RX_CLK with 4-bit data lanes, while SGMII employs differential 625 MHz clock/data pairs (SGMII_SIP/SON/COP/CON). The DP83867ERGZR does not multiplex these interfaces on shared pins.

How does the RJ45 mirror mode function in DP83867ERGZR?

RJ45 mirror mode in DP83867ERGZR routes internal MDI signals directly to dedicated test pins (TD_P_A/M_A through TD_P_D/M_D) without magnetics or line drivers, enabling physical-layer signal observation with an oscilloscope. This mode is activated via register bit MIR_CTRL[0] and supports real-time debugging of link training, auto-negotiation, and cable fault signatures - a capability not present in standard PHYs and critical for field-deployed industrial equipment validation.

What clock sources are compatible with DP83867ERGZR's XI pin?

The XI pin of DP83867ERGZR accepts a 25 MHz fundamental-mode crystal (50 ppm tolerance) or a 25 MHz CMOS-compatible oscillator with 1.5–1.9 Vpp input swing. When using a crystal, XO must be left floating; when using an oscillator, XO is unused. The DP83867ERGZR does not support 125 MHz reference clocks on XI - that frequency is generated internally and provided on CLK_OUT for MAC synchronization.

Can DP83867ERGZR perform cable diagnostics without external firmware?

Yes, DP83867ERGZR implements autonomous cable diagnostics in hardware, detecting opens, shorts, and pair swaps on all four MDI differential pairs without host processor intervention. Results are reported via MDIO registers (CABLE_DIAG_STATUS) after initiating the diagnostic sequence through register CABLE_DIAG_CTRL. This feature operates independently of the MAC and requires no firmware development - a key differentiator versus basic PHYs requiring software-based TDR emulation.
